When does the letter Y make the long e sound?
The letter Y as a Vowel is more common than Y as a consonant. When the letter “y” is at the end of word, it sometimes makes the long e sound, e.g., baby, candy, family and city. Y as a vowel at the end of a word can also make the long i sound, e.g., my, cry. The table below contains over 275 long E words.
Which is an example of the long e sound?
The long E sound can be represented in 2 vowel teams (“ea” and “ee”), an irregular vowel team (“ie”), the open syllable rule, e.g., me, and “Y” as a vowel at the end of a word, e.g. bunny. 5 Ways to Spell the Long E Sound. The vowel team rule states that when two vowels go walking, the first one does the talking.
